100% - What annoys me is the lack of a Hearts perspective on it - Yes objectively, Rangers are a bigger club that play on a bigger stage. But Shankland is under contract and this idea that Rangers just rip off some £20 sheets and chuck them at us and we're supposed to meekly accept is just ****ing offensive. 

 

Euan Cameron for example, as the so called Hearts voice should be highlighting pretty voraciously that there are 18 months on his contract, he's our best striker since Robbo and his goals will go a long way to delivering successive 3rd place finishes and a combined £10m in prize money. There is no deal Rangers can offer which is beneficial to our club. Chucking us some cast offs like Wright or whoever, whilst potentially welcome, doesn't negate how big a hole filing Shanks place in the squad would be but because of the media, all they are seeing is the Rangers side of this and totally and utterly failing to recognise Hearts position. TBH Its a bit like the Dhanda situaiton, Ross County value him at X we value him at Y, if County are not satisfied with Y, then they don't sell him and we don't get the player. We don't have a right to him just because we're a bigger club. 

 

I think a stage further is highlighting that he doesn't fit Clements style of football either. Rangers play with a pacey striker, Shankland as we've seen doesn't have pace to burn so likely wouldn't be able to get on the end of the quick attacks Clement is trying make a staple of their way of playing. He would AT BEST be a bit part player thrown on to score goals when they need one. Shankland wouldn't be going there as Clements number 9. If Shankland played like Leigh Griffiths, I could totally see him fitting into Clements style of play, but he's more of a Kris Boyd type and that isn't how Rangers are playing. IMHO it would be Lafferty all over again - and I'm fairly confident Gerrard didn't want him either.

Shankland offered improved Hearts deal

Sky Sports understands Hearts have made a second contract offer to captain Lawrence Shankland.

The Edinburgh side put a new deal to the striker earlier this month however it wasn’t accepted by the Scotland international.

They have now offered improved terms that would tie Shankland to the club for the next three-and-a-half years.

Shankland has scored 20 goals this season for club and country.
